stainless steel shims are versatile tools that play a crucial role in various industrial applications. These thin pieces of metal are used to fill gaps and spaces between objects to provide support, alignment, and leveling. stainless steel shims are preferred over other materials due to their superior strength, durability, and corrosion resistance. One of the key advantages of stainless steel shims is their exceptional durability. Stainless steel is known for its high tensile strength and resistance to corrosion, making it ideal for applications that require long-lasting performance. Unlike other materials such as plastic or aluminum, stainless steel shims can withstand heavy loads and extreme conditions without losing their shape or integrity. This makes them a reliable choice for industrial machinery, equipment, and structures that are subject to constant wear and tear.
Another benefit of stainless steel shims is their precision and accuracy. These shims are manufactured with strict tolerances to ensure uniform thickness and dimensional stability. This level of precision is crucial for applications where accuracy is paramount, such as in aerospace, automotive, and manufacturing industries. stainless steel shims provide a consistent and reliable solution for aligning and adjusting components to achieve optimal performance and efficiency.
In addition to their durability and precision, stainless steel shims offer excellent resistance to corrosion and chemicals. Stainless steel is a non-reactive material that does not rust or degrade when exposed to moisture, chemicals, or harsh environments. This makes stainless steel shims suitable for use in marine, oil and gas, and food processing industries where exposure to corrosive substances is common. The resistance of stainless steel shims to rust and corrosion ensures that they maintain their strength and integrity over time, even in challenging conditions.
Stainless steel shims are also easy to install and remove, thanks to their thin and flexible design. These shims can be inserted between components or surfaces to adjust gaps and alignment with minimal effort. Stainless steel shims are available in various shapes and sizes to accommodate different applications and requirements. Whether used for leveling machinery, aligning structures, or adjusting clearances, stainless steel shims provide a cost-effective and practical solution for industrial purposes.
